## Formula sandbox tuning

User-supplied formulas in Gridmoor execute inside a restricted interpreter with hard ceilings on time, memory, and call depth. Reviewers should confirm any change to these ceilings is justified in the PR description, since raising them widens the abuse surface. Defaults were chosen from production traces. The current limits are as follows.

limits module of tafog-fawip:
WEIGHTS = {
    "julix": 57,
    "lamys": 992,
    "kasvan": 209,
    "quenok": 750,
    "alddor": 259,
    "oliath": 1009,
    "wenix": 815,
}

Subject: Quickstore 4.2 — bloom filter now fronts the KV layer

Plugin authors: starting with this release, Quickstore places a bloom filter ahead of the key-value store. Negative lookups return faster; false positives fall through safely. No API changes are required on your side. Verify your plugin against the staging build referenced below.

session token of fahif-tadup = htk3_9c7

Handover: contrast audit, Marigold UI

Finished pass one of the color-contrast audit. Fixed 31 of 44 failures; remaining ones are in the charting package and need design input. Tokens updated in theme/core; don't hand-edit hex values, regenerate from the palette script. Audit tooling runs in CI on every merge — failures block release. Full findings spreadsheet and before/after screenshots are in the locked audit archive. Future maintainers can open the archive with the recovery passphrase below.

unlock words, yawig-kagef: gordor-holvan-ulaael-pramir-ulaiel-tamdor